Al Minya Sunshine Hours by Month
To truly understand a climate, we must look at its sunshine. This page shows the total number of hours of direct sunlight per month and the average hours per day in Al Minya, Egypt. The figures are based on a 30-year period (1990–2020) to provide a reliable average.
Monthly hours of sunshine
Across the seasons, sunshine hours in Al Minya vary. From a high of 385 hours in July, to a low of 240 hours in December, the city offers a balanced mix of sunny and overcast days. The total annual sunshine amounts to 3689 hours.
Daily hours of sunshine
The difference in daily sunshine hours between July (12.8 hours per day) and December (8.0 hours per day) offers moderate variety for visitors and residents.
Al Minya vs Major Cities: Sunshine Compared
Al Minya enjoys an average of 3689 hours of sunshine annually. Let’s compare this with some popular tourist destinations:
In Lisbon, Portugal, there are approximately 2801 hours of sunshine annually, highlighting its warm and sunny Mediterranean climate.
Manchester, UK, experiences just around 1420 hours of sunshine annually.
Beijing, China, has 2505 hours of sunshine annually, with clear, sunny days in winter.
Melbourne, Australia, has 2380 hours of sunshine annually, with its famous “four seasons in a day” weather pattern.
